A10 Notice of Bankruptcy Tarrant Texas Notice of Bankruptcy is a legal document that officially declares an individual or company's bankruptcy status in Tarrant County, Texas. This notice is typically filed with the local bankruptcy court and serves as a public record indicating financial distress and the commencement of bankruptcy proceedings. Different types of Tarrant Texas Notice of Bankruptcy include: 1. Chapter 7 Bankruptcy Notice: This type of notice is filed under Chapter 7 of the United States Bankruptcy Code, which involves the liquidation of assets to repay creditors. It is most commonly used by individuals and small businesses in Tarrant County, Texas, facing overwhelming debt and looking for a fresh start financially. 2. Chapter 13 Bankruptcy Notice: This notice is filed under Chapter 13 of the Bankruptcy Code, intended for individuals with a regular income who wish to repay their debts over a set period of time. It involves the creation of a repayment plan, allowing debtors to keep their assets while making scheduled payments to creditors. 3. Chapter 11 Bankruptcy Notice: This notice is filed under Chapter 11 of the Bankruptcy Code, primarily used by businesses and corporations located in Tarrant County, Texas, to reorganize their debts and operations while remaining in control of their business affairs. Chapter 11 bankruptcy allows companies to continue operating, presenting a chance for financial recovery. 4. Chapter 12 Bankruptcy Notice: This notice is specific to family farmers and fishermen in Tarrant County, Texas, who seek to restructure their debts under Chapter 12 of the Bankruptcy Code. Chapter 12 bankruptcy provides a specialized and tailored approach to address the unique challenges faced by those in the agricultural industry. In summary, a Tarrant Texas Notice of Bankruptcy is a vital legal document that signals the initiation of bankruptcy proceedings in Tarrant County, Texas. It may come in different types including Chapter 7, Chapter 13, Chapter 11, and Chapter 12, depending on the specific circumstances and financial situation of the debtor. These notices play a key role in informing the public and creditors about the bankruptcy status of individuals and businesses.
